Lumentum Holdings Inc.’s recent $1.1 billion convertible notes offering, priced at a 0.375% coupon and maturing in March 2032, represents a calculated move to optimize its capital structure while aligning with long-term growth ambitions. The offering, which includes a 40% premium conversion price of $187.77 per share and a cap price of $268.24, reflects the company’s confidence in its stock’s upside potential amid surging demand for optical hardware driven by the AI and cloud revolution [2]. In Q4 2025, the company reported revenue of $480.7 million, surpassing analyst forecasts and marking a 67% year-over-year increase in its cloud and networking segment [3]. This growth, fueled by robust EML shipments and expanding optical circuit switch (OCS) capacity, underscores Lumentum’s leadership in a sector poised for sustained expansion. The convertible notes offering allows the firm to reinvest in its core strengths—such as scaling production for cloud modules—while maintaining financial flexibility for acquisitions and capital expenditures [1].

Following its Q4 earnings report, the stock surged 4.03% in after-hours trading, reflecting investor optimism about the company’s ability to capitalize on AI-driven demand [3]. With management targeting $600 million in quarterly revenue by fiscal Q4 2026, the proceeds from the convertible notes will play a pivotal role in funding capacity expansions and R&D initiatives [3].
Critically, the offering also addresses Lumentum’s near-term liquidity needs. By repurchasing its 2026 notes, the company reduces refinancing risks and extends its debt maturity profile, a prudent step in a high-interest-rate environment. The $88.7 million allocated to capped call transactions further insulates shareholders from dilution, ensuring that the conversion of the new notes does not erode earnings per share [2].
In the broader context, Lumentum’s move mirrors trends in the optical components sector, where firms are leveraging convertible debt to fund growth while preserving equity value. As AI and cloud infrastructure spending accelerates, companies that can scale production efficiently—like Lumentum—will likely outperform peers reliant on traditional financing models.
